IBM Tivoli Netcool/OMNIbus_GUI 8.1.0 is vulnerable to stored cross-site scripting, potentially leading to credentials disclosure within a trusted session.
Understanding CVE-2021-20336
This CVE refers to a stored cross-site scripting vulnerability in IBM Tivoli Netcool/OMNIbus_GUI 8.1.0, exposing systems to the risk of unauthorized JavaScript injection.
What is CVE-2021-20336?
The vulnerability in IBM Tivoli Netcool/OMNIbus_GUI 8.1.0 allows threat actors to insert malicious JavaScript code into the Web UI, potentially compromising system integrity and exposing sensitive information.
The Impact of CVE-2021-20336
This vulnerability poses a medium-level risk with a CVSS base score of 6.4, enabling attackers to alter the system's intended functionality and potentially disclose credentials within a trusted session.
Technical Details of CVE-2021-20336
This section outlines the specifics of the vulnerability, including affected systems and the exploitation mechanism.
Vulnerability Description
The vulnerability allows users to embed arbitrary JavaScript code in the Web UI, affecting the intended functionality of the system and opening possibilities for unauthorized access.
Affected Systems and Versions
IBM Tivoli Netcool/OMNIbus_GUI version 8.1.0 is confirmed to be affected by this vulnerability, putting installations at risk of exploitation.
Exploitation Mechanism
Attackers can exploit this vulnerability by injecting JavaScript code into the Web UI, manipulating system behavior, and potentially gaining access to sensitive credentials.
